图像识别精度测试的第一步是选择合适的测试数据集。数据集应具备以下特点:
标题:图像识别精度测试:如何评估AI模型的准确度?
一、测试目的与意义
在人工智能领域,图像识别技术是众多应用场景的核心。评估图像识别模型的精度,对于确保AI系统在实际应用中的可靠性和有效性至关重要。本文将探讨如何进行图像识别精度测试,以及如何理解测试结果。
二、测试数据集
图像识别精度测试的第一步是选择合适的测试数据集。数据集应具备以下特点:
1. 代表性:数据集应涵盖各种场景和物体,以反映实际应用中的多样性。
2. 质量高:数据集中的图像应清晰、无噪声,标注准确。
3. 规模适中:数据集规模不宜过大,以免影响测试效率。
常用的图像识别数据集包括ImageNet、COCO、PASCAL VOC等。
三、测试方法
1. 交叉验证:将数据集划分为训练集、验证集和测试集,通过交叉验证来评估模型的性能。
2. 一致性测试:对同一数据集进行多次测试,比较结果的一致性,以排除偶然误差。
3. 随机测试:随机选取数据集中的图像进行测试,以评估模型的泛化能力。
四、评价指标
1. 准确率(Accuracy):模型正确识别图像的比例。
2. 精确率(Precision):模型正确识别正例的比例。
3. 召回率(Recall):模型正确识别负例的比例。
4. F1分数(F1 Score):精确率和召回率的调和平均数。
五、注意事项
1. 避免过拟合:在测试过程中,确保模型没有过拟合训练数据。
2. 考虑数据不平衡:在数据集中,正负样本比例可能不均衡,需要采取措施处理。
3. 分析测试结果:对测试结果进行深入分析,找出模型的优势和不足。
通过以上方法,可以较为全面地评估图像识别模型的精度。在实际应用中,应根据具体需求选择合适的测试方法,并关注模型的实际表现。
本文由 广州市工程有限公司 整理发布。